What is Kinetic Lifting?

Kinetic lifting is more than simply hoisting weights; it is an innovative fitness methodology that emphasizes dynamic movement, efficient force transfer, and real-world functionality. Unlike traditional lifting, which often isolates muscles through repetitive, static exercises, kinetic resistance training engages multiple muscle groups and joints through fluid, natural motions. This style of training mimics the activities encountered in sports, work, and daily life, making it a vastly functional form of exercise.

Core Principles of Kinetic Lifting

  • Multi-Planar Movement: Incorporates movement through various planes--sagittal, frontal, and transverse.
  • Integrated Muscle Activation: Encourages activation of synergistic muscle groups, enhancing overall coordination.
  • Controlled Speed: Focuses on the tempo, acceleration, and deceleration of movements for greater muscle engagement.
  • Functional Patterns: Replicates motions found in real-life activities and sports.

Why Incorporate Kinetic Lifting Into Your Training?

Whether you are building muscle, burning fat, or seeking improved movement efficiency, incorporating kinetic lifting in your workouts can yield numerous advantages. Here are key reasons to add this innovative form of training to your regimen:

Enhanced Functional Strength

Traditional isolation exercises may improve strength in specific muscles but often fail to address overall body coordination. Kinetic lifts train the body as a unified system, improving your ability to generate and control force in real-world scenarios. For example, activities like lifting a box, sprinting, or jumping all involve coordinated movement patterns that benefit from kinetic-style training.

Increased Core Stability and Balance

Kinetic weightlifting movements activate the core and stabilizing muscles to a much greater extent than static lifts. This results in:

  • Improved posture,
  • Reduced injury risk,
  • Enhanced athletic performance.

Stability and balance training embedded into kinetic lifting routines also enhances agility, coordination, and proprioception (your body's sense of its position in space).

Boosted Caloric Burn and Metabolic Rate

Because kinetic lifting involves full-body, often explosive movements, it significantly increases heart rate and energy expenditure. This delivers:

  • Superior fat-burning potential,
  • Increased metabolic afterburn,
  • Greater improvements in cardiovascular health.

By integrating kinetic-based lifts, you maximize both strength and cardio benefits in one session.

Heightened Athletic Performance

Sports and daily life require more than brute strength--they require power, speed, coordination, and resilience. Incorporating kinetic resistance routines trains your muscles, tendons, joints, and nervous system to handle complex and dynamic tasks. Athletes in particular see marked improvements in:

  • Explosive power (e.g., sprinting, jumping),
  • Change-of-direction speed,
  • Sport-specific movement efficiency,
  • Injury prevention (due to stronger stabilizers and connective tissues).

Injury Prevention and Joint Health

Static weightlifting sometimes subjects joints and muscles to unnatural or repeated stress. In contrast, dynamic kinetic lifting promotes optimal joint mechanics and muscle synergy, distributing loads more evenly throughout the body. This reduces chronic strain, supports healthy range of motion, and fosters long-term joint resilience.

Key Kinetic Lifting Exercises and Movements

To integrate kinetic lifting into your routine, start with these foundational exercises that emphasize movement, control, and dynamic force output. Mix these variations into your training program for balanced, functional gains.

1. Kettlebell Swings

  • Emphasizes: Hip drive, core engagement, and dynamic power.
  • Benefits: Builds explosive strength, conditions the posterior chain, and improves cardiovascular health.

2. Medicine Ball Slams

  • Emphasizes: Full-body coordination, upper body power, and rotational strength.
  • Benefits: Engages multiple muscle groups and teaches forceful movement patterns.

3. Turkish Get-Ups

  • Emphasizes: Functional movement complexity, core stability, joint mobility.
  • Benefits: Promotes total-body strength and injury resilience.

4. Dynamic Lunges with Rotation

  • Emphasizes: Lower body strength, balance, and rotational control.
  • Benefits: Develops multi-plane stability and core strength.

5. Landmine Presses

  • Emphasizes: Functional pushing mechanics, shoulder stability.
  • Benefits: Trains upper-body strength while encouraging natural movement patterns.

How to Add Kinetic Lifting to Your Fitness Routine

To reap the benefits of kinetic exercise, strategic planning and correct execution are essential. Here's how you can seamlessly incorporate dynamic kinetic lifts into any training program:

  • Start Light: Focus on mastering technique before increasing intensity or load.
  • Mix Movements: Pair kinetic lifts with traditional strength moves for a balanced approach.
  • Progress Gradually: Increase complexity or resistance as coordination improves.
  • Emphasize Quality Over Quantity: Controlled, precise movement yields better results than rushed repetitions.
  • Warm Up Properly: Prepare the joints and muscles with mobility and activation drills to prevent injury.

Sample Kinetic Lifting Workout

  1. Complex warm-up (mobility + activation, 10 minutes)
  2. Kettlebell swings - 3 sets of 15-20 reps
  3. Medicine ball slams - 3 sets of 12 reps
  4. Dynamic lunges with rotation - 3 sets of 10 reps each side
  5. Turkish get-ups - 2 sets of 3 reps each side
  6. Optional: Landmine press - 3 sets of 10 reps
  7. Cool down and stretching (10 minutes)

Kinetic Lifting for Different Fitness Levels

  • Beginners: Focus on learning basic movement patterns, using body weight or light weights. Prioritize coordination and control.
  • Intermediates: Gradually increase load, complexity, and integrate single-leg or overhead variations.
  • Advanced: Incorporate kettlebell flows, plyometrics, or complex combinations for greater challenge.

If uncertain or new to exercise, consult a certified trainer to perfect your form and tailor kinetic lifting methods to your individual needs.

Safety Considerations and Tips

While kinetic resistance exercise offers many advantages, correct form and appropriate progressions are crucial for safety. Here are some essential tips:

  • Prioritize form over weight: Perfect movement mechanics before adding load or speed.
  • Use functional, free-moving equipment: Kettlebells, bands, medicine balls, and landmines offer more kinetic benefits than fixed machines.
  • Listen to your body: If you experience pain beyond normal muscle fatigue, stop and reassess technique.
  • Ensure sufficient recovery: Dynamic lifts can be demanding; balance intensity with adequate rest.

Equipment for Kinetic Lifting

The right tools amplify the effectiveness of your kinetic lifting sessions. Common kinetic lifting equipment includes:

  • Kettlebells: Versatile, ideal for swinging and flowing movements
  • Medicine balls: Excellent for throws, slams, and rotational drills
  • Resistance bands: Portable, great for horizontal and diagonal resistance
  • Landmine bars: Encourage multi-directional presses and rotations
  • Battle ropes: For explosive power and coordination
  • Bosu balls/balance devices: Promote stability and proprioception

Starting with body weight and gradually introducing equipment will help optimize learning and reduce risk.
